Jazz Dance Costumes: A Guide to Styling Your Performance

Jazz dance is a high-energy, expressive style of dance that requires a lot of movement and flexibility. To fully showcase your skills and make a statement on stage, it's important to choose the right costume for your performance. In this guide, we'll go over some key factors to consider when selecting your jazz dance costume.

1. Comfort and Mobility

When choosing a costume, it's important to prioritize comfort and mobility. You want to be able to move freely and comfortably on stage, without any restrictions or distractions. Look for costumes that are made from stretchy, breathable fabrics, and that allow for a full range of motion. Avoid costumes that are too tight or restrictive, as they can inhibit your movement and detract from your performance.

2. Style and Aesthetic

Jazz dance is known for its bold, dynamic style, so it's important to choose a costume that reflects this. Look for costumes that are eye-catching and make a statement, whether it's through the use of bright colors, bold patterns, or interesting silhouettes. Consider the overall aesthetic of your performance and choose a costume that complements and enhances it.

3. Fit and Fitment

A well-fitting costume can make all the difference in your performance. It's important to choose a costume that fits you well and flatters your body shape. Look for costumes that are tailored to fit your body, and that provide support where you need it. Avoid costumes that are too loose or baggy, as they can detract from your performance and make you look sloppy on stage.

4. Accessories and Details

Accessories and details can add a lot of personality and flair to your jazz dance costume. Consider adding things like jewelry, scarves, or hats to your costume to make it more interesting and unique. Just be sure to choose accessories that are secure and won't fall off or get in the way during your performance.

5. Budget and Quality

Finally, it's important to consider your budget and the quality of the costume when making your decision. Look for costumes that are well-made and durable, but that also fit within your budget. Don't be afraid to shop around and compare prices to find the best deal.
